NCIt definition : A humanized IgG1 monoclonal antibody directed against the placenta growth factor (PGF),
with potential anti-angiogenic and antineoplastic activities. Anti-PGF monoclonal
antibody RO5323441 binds to both PGF-1 and -2, thereby inhibiting the binding of PGF-1
and -2 to the vascular endothelial growth factor receptor-1 (VEGFR-1) and subsequent
VEGFR-1 phosphorylation. This may result in the inhibition of tumor angiogenesis and
tumor cell proliferation. PGF, a member of the VEGF sub-family and a key molecule
in angiogenesis and vasculogenesis, is upregulated in many cancers.;
